博客 基于分布式架构的能源数据治理技术实现

基于分布式架构的能源数据治理技术实现

   数栈君   发表于 2026-03-03 09:08  40  0

随着能源行业的数字化转型加速,能源数据的规模和复杂性也在快速增长。如何高效、安全地管理和治理能源数据,成为企业面临的重要挑战。基于分布式架构的能源数据治理技术,作为一种创新的解决方案,正在得到越来越多的关注和应用。本文将深入探讨这一技术的实现细节、应用场景以及对企业数字化转型的推动作用。


一、能源数据治理的背景与挑战

在能源行业中,数据治理是确保数据质量、一致性和安全性的核心任务。能源数据的来源广泛,包括传感器数据、生产系统数据、用户行为数据等,这些数据需要经过清洗、整合和分析,才能为企业决策提供支持。

然而,能源数据治理面临以下主要挑战:

  1. 数据孤岛问题:传统集中式架构容易导致数据孤岛,不同系统之间的数据难以共享和整合。
  2. 数据一致性与实时性:能源数据的实时性和一致性要求较高,尤其是在智能电网和能源互联网场景中。
  3. 数据安全与隐私:能源数据往往涉及敏感信息,如何在分布式架构下保障数据安全和隐私是一个重要问题。
  4. 系统扩展性与灵活性:随着能源行业的快速发展,数据量和业务需求也在不断增长,系统需要具备良好的扩展性和灵活性。

二、分布式架构的核心优势

分布式架构是一种将数据和计算任务分散到多个节点的技术,具有以下显著优势:

  1. 高可用性:通过节点间的负载均衡和容错机制,确保系统在部分节点故障时仍能正常运行。
  2. 可扩展性:可以根据业务需求动态扩展节点,满足数据量和计算能力的增长需求。
  3. 灵活性:支持多种数据存储和计算方式,适用于复杂的能源数据场景。
  4. 数据一致性:通过分布式一致性算法(如Paxos、Raft等),确保多个节点的数据副本保持一致。

三、基于分布式架构的能源数据治理技术实现

基于分布式架构的能源数据治理技术,主要从以下几个方面进行实现:

1. 数据分区与分片

数据分区与分片是分布式架构中的核心技术之一。通过将数据按一定规则分散到不同的节点或存储设备中,可以实现数据的负载均衡和高效访问。

  • 分区策略:常见的分区策略包括哈希分区、范围分区和模运算分区。选择合适的分区策略,可以提高数据的读写效率。
  • 分片机制:分片机制通过将数据划分为多个逻辑单元,每个单元由一个节点负责,从而实现数据的并行处理。

2. 分布式事务与一致性

在分布式系统中,事务的原子性、一致性、隔离性和持久性(ACID)是确保数据正确性的关键。能源数据治理需要处理复杂的事务场景,例如多节点数据更新和跨系统数据同步。

  • 分布式事务管理:通过分布式事务管理器(如TCC、XA等),确保跨节点事务的原子性和一致性。
  • 一致性协议:使用一致性算法(如Raft、Paxos)确保分布式系统中数据副本的一致性。

3. 数据同步与复制

在分布式架构中,数据的同步与复制是保障数据可用性和一致性的关键环节。

  • 数据同步机制:通过心跳机制、日志同步等方式,确保各节点的数据副本保持一致。
  • 数据复制策略:根据业务需求,选择合适的复制因子和副本分布策略,提高数据的可靠性和容灾能力。

4. 负载均衡与容错机制

负载均衡和容错机制是分布式系统中保障高可用性的核心技术。

  • 负载均衡:通过负载均衡算法(如轮询、随机、加权等),将请求均匀分配到多个节点,避免单点过载。
  • 容错机制:通过节点健康检查和故障转移策略,确保在节点故障时能够快速恢复服务。

四、能源数据治理的典型应用场景

基于分布式架构的能源数据治理技术,在以下场景中得到了广泛应用:

1. 智能电网数据管理

智能电网需要实时监控和管理大量的电力设备和用户数据。通过分布式架构,可以实现数据的实时采集、分析和决策,提升电网的运行效率和可靠性。

  • 数据采集与处理:通过分布式传感器和边缘计算节点,实时采集电力设备的运行数据,并进行初步处理。
  • 数据存储与分析:利用分布式数据库和大数据分析平台,对海量数据进行存储和分析,支持电网的智能调度和故障诊断。

2. 能源互联网数据共享

能源互联网要求不同能源系统(如电力、天然气、可再生能源等)之间的数据共享与协同。分布式架构可以实现跨系统数据的高效共享和协同管理。

  • 数据共享平台:通过分布式数据共享平台,实现不同能源系统之间的数据互联互通。
  • 数据隐私保护:通过区块链等技术,在分布式架构下保障数据共享的安全性和隐私性。

3. 可再生能源数据管理

可再生能源(如风能、太阳能)具有波动性和间歇性,对数据的实时性和准确性要求较高。分布式架构可以实现对可再生能源数据的实时监控和优化管理。

  • 分布式预测与优化:通过分布式计算和机器学习算法,对可再生能源的输出进行预测和优化。
  • 数据协同控制:通过分布式控制算法,实现对可再生能源设备的协同控制,提高系统的稳定性和效率。

五、能源数据治理的挑战与解决方案

尽管分布式架构在能源数据治理中具有诸多优势,但在实际应用中仍面临一些挑战:

1. 数据一致性与延迟问题

在分布式系统中,数据一致性与网络延迟之间存在天然的矛盾。为了解决这一问题,可以采用以下措施:

  • 优化一致性算法:选择适合业务场景的一致性算法,平衡一致性与延迟。
  • 分层架构设计:通过分层架构(如数据层、计算层、应用层)实现数据的分层管理,降低一致性开销。

2. 系统复杂性与运维难度

分布式系统的复杂性较高,对运维人员的技术要求也较高。为了解决这一问题,可以采用以下措施:

  • 自动化运维工具:通过自动化运维工具(如容器化编排、监控系统等),简化系统的部署和运维。
  • 模块化设计:通过模块化设计,降低系统的耦合性,提高系统的可维护性。

3. 数据安全与隐私保护

在分布式架构下,数据的安全性和隐私保护是一个重要挑战。为了解决这一问题,可以采用以下措施:

  • 区块链技术:通过区块链技术实现数据的分布式存储和不可篡改性,保障数据的安全性。
  • 隐私计算技术:通过隐私计算技术(如联邦学习、安全多方计算等),在保护数据隐私的前提下实现数据的共享和分析。

六、结语

基于分布式架构的能源数据治理技术,为企业提供了高效、安全、灵活的数据管理解决方案。通过数据分区、分布式事务、数据同步与复制等技术,可以实现能源数据的高可用性和一致性。同时,分布式架构在智能电网、能源互联网和可再生能源管理等场景中的应用,为企业数字化转型提供了重要支持。

未来,随着技术的不断发展,分布式架构在能源数据治理中的应用将更加广泛和深入。企业可以通过申请试用相关技术平台(申请试用),探索分布式架构在能源数据治理中的潜力,进一步提升企业的数据管理水平和竞争力。


通过本文的介绍,您对基于分布式架构的能源数据治理技术有了更深入的了解。如果您对相关技术感兴趣,可以申请试用相关平台(申请试用),体验分布式架构在能源数据治理中的实际应用效果。

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料